P
O Começo Notícias
Menu
×

Sistemas de Registro em Aplicativos Móveis: Como Garantir a Segurança e a Eficiência

Os sistemas de registro são fundamentais para o bom funcionamento dos aplicativos móveis, permitindo o rastreamento e a análise do comportamento do aplicativo e dos usuários. Vamos explorar em detalhes como esses sistemas operam, suas vantagens, e melhores práticas para otimizar sua implantação e uso.

O que são Sistemas de Registro em Aplicativos Móveis?

Sistemas de registro, também conhecidos como logging systems, são ferramentas críticas que ajudam desenvolvedores e engenheiros a monitorar e depurar aplicativos móveis. Esses sistemas registram eventos, erros, interações do usuário e outros dados significativos que ocorrem durante o uso do aplicativo. Com esses registros, as equipes de desenvolvimento podem identificar problemas, melhorar a experiência do usuário e garantir a operação suave do aplicativo. Além de fornecer insights sobre o uso do aplicativo, os sistemas de registro também são fundamentais para áreas como segurança e compliance.

Esses sistemas não apenas capturam informações críticas, mas também ajudam a identificar padrões e tendências ao longo do tempo. Isso pode ser crucial para empresas que buscam aprimorar suas ofertas de produtos ou serviços com base no feedback dos usuários. Ao entender como os usuários interagem com um aplicativo, as empresas podem tomar decisões informadas para aprimorar funcionalidades, corrigir problemas frequentes e, em última análise, aumentar a retenção de usuários. Dessa forma, a implementação eficaz de sistemas de registro pode ser um diferencial competitivo significativo no vasto mercado de aplicativos móveis.

Vantagens dos Sistemas de Registro

A implementação de sistemas de registro em aplicativos móveis traz inúmeras vantagens que beneficiam tanto os usuários quanto os desenvolvedores. Uma das principais vantagens é a capacidade de antecipar e resolver rapidamente falhas e bugs através da análise de registros. Com informações detalhadas sobre o comportamento do aplicativo, as equipes podem identificar problemas antes que eles afetem negativamente a experiência do usuário. Isso reduz o tempo de inatividade e melhora a satisfação geral do cliente.

Além disso, os sistemas de registro podem ajudar a otimizar o desempenho do aplicativo. Por exemplo, os registros podem fornecer dados sobre os recursos mais usados ou sobrecarregados, permitindo que os desenvolvedores façam ajustes necessários para melhorar o tempo de resposta e a eficiência. Adicionalmente, esses sistemas oferecem suporte aos requisitos de conformidade e regulamentação, garantindo que os dados confidenciais sejam manejados e armazenados de maneira segura.

Outra vantagem significativa é a capacidade de personalizar a experiência do usuário. Analisando padrões de uso e comportamento, as empresas podem oferecer conteúdos personalizados e promoções direcionadas que ressoem melhor com o público-alvo. Isso não só melhora a experiência do usuário, mas também pode impulsionar receitas e fortalecer a lealdade do cliente em longo prazo.

Melhores Práticas para Implementação

Implementar um sistema de registro eficaz requer consideração cuidadosa de vários fatores. Primeiramente, é importante garantir que os registros capturam dados relevantes sem comprometer o desempenho do aplicativo. Isso significa encontrar um equilíbrio entre a quantidade de informação coletada e o potencial impacto nos tempos de carregamento e na utilização de recursos. Limitar os registros a eventos críticos e erros pode ajudar a manter a eficiência.

Outra consideração importante é a segurança dos dados registrados. Certifique-se de que todos os dados sensíveis capturados nos registros sejam criptografados e armazenados de forma segura para proteger a privacidade dos usuários. Mantenha conformidade com regulamentações de privacidade e segurança, como o GDPR, para evitar sanções legais e danos à reputação.

Além disso, utilize ferramentas de análise e monitoração que integrem facilmente com o sistema de registro escolhido para maximizar a utilidade dos dados coletados. Estabeleça alertas automáticos para eventos específicos, como falhas ou picos inesperados na carga do sistema, de modo a garantir respostas rápidas e proativas a quaisquer problemas.

Ainda, é crucial treinar e capacitar sua equipe para interpretar e agir sobre os dados de registro de forma eficaz. Ter processos bem definidos para lidar com esses dados, juntamente com um plano de ação claro para abordagens pós-diagnóstico, pode melhorar consideravelmente a eficiência operacional.

Por fim, os sistemas de registro em aplicativos móveis não são estáticos. Revisite e atualize suas estratégias regularmente para se adaptar às novas tendências, tecnologias emergentes e às constantes mudanças do comportamento do usuário. Estar à frente no jogo dos aplicativos móveis pode ser a chave para o sucesso e a longevidade no mercado competitivo de hoje.


Artigos que lhe podem interessar:

Sistemas de Orquestração Linux: Uma Visão Abrangente

Gestão de Dispositivos Móveis Android: Melhores Práticas e Dicas

Sistemas de Gestão de Testes para Aplicações Móveis

Segurança de Redes em Arquiteturas Serverless: Desafios e Soluções

Introdução ao Linux API Gateways: Guia Completo e Práticas Recomendadas

Ferramentas de Virtualização no CloudOps: Otimização e Eficiência

Software de Gerenciamento de Projetos de TI e Gestão de Ativos: A Chave para Eficiências Aprimoradas

Sistemas de Prevenção de Perda de Dados para iOS: Guia Completo e Atualizado

Automatização de Ferramentas de Gestão de Projetos de Software

Otimizando Pipelines CI/CD com Kanban: Uma Abordagem Eficiente

Melhores Práticas em Sistemas de Orquestração no Windows

Gestão de Patches para iOS: Sistema Eficiente e Seguro

Análise das Melhores Ferramentas de Scanner de Vulnerabilidades Linux

Ferramentas de Automação do Windows: Simplifique Suas Tarefas

Sistemas de Orquestração de TI: Como Otimizar a Infraestrutura Tecnológica

Migração para a Nuvem com Ferramentas Android: Tudo o Que Você Precisa Saber

Gerenciamento de Dispositivos Móveis ITIL: Melhores Práticas e Benefícios

Compreendendo os Balanceadores de Carga Linux

Gestão de Ativos de TI com Software ITIL: Descubra as Melhores Práticas

Gerenciamento de Projetos de Software: Ferramentas de Gestão de Containers

Ferramentas de Gestão de Contêineres Kanban: Otimização e Eficiência

Ferramentas de Automação em Segurança de Redes: Proteja Sua Infraestrutura de Forma Eficiente

Gerenciamento de Microserviços com CloudOps: Boas Práticas e Estratégias

Pipelines de CI/CD: Otimize Seus Processos de Desenvolvimento de Software

Gestão De Microserviços iOS: Melhores Práticas Para Desenvolvedores